Solution Overview

Problem

Current systems for sending digital images over networks lack efficient methods for automatically identifying and sharing photos based on facial recognition, particularly in scenarios where users may not have direct contact information for all individuals in the images.

Innovation Solution

The system employs facial recognition algorithms, such as eigenfaces, to identify individuals in images and correlate them with contact information, allowing for automatic sharing of photos via email, SMS, or social networks, even if the individuals do not have known contact details, by utilizing a client-server architecture and synchronization of facial recognition data across devices.

Solution Approach 1:

The patent introduces a server as an intermediary component that hosts the facial recognition database and processing algorithms. The mobile device communicates with this server to perform facial recognition, thereby offloading the computational complexity from the client device while maintaining ease of operation for the user.

Data Source

PatentUS10515261B2System and methods for sending digital images
Publication Date: 2019.12.24 APPLE INC

AI summary

Facial recognition algorithms may identify the faces of one or more people in a digital image. Multiple types of communication may be available for the different people in the digital image. A user interface may be presented indicating recognized faces along with the available forms of communication for the corresponding person. An indication of the total number of people available to be communicated with using each form of communication may be presented. The user may have the option to choose one or more forms of communication, causing the digital image to be sent to the recipients using the selected forms of communication. An individual may have provided information for facial recognition of the individual to a service. Based on the information, the service may recognize that the individual is in an uploaded picture and send the digital image to the user account of the individual.
